Understanding Animal Acupuncture

Animal acupuncture involves the insertion of thin, sterile needles into specific points on an animal’s body to stimulate natural healing. These acupuncture points are carefully chosen based on their ability to influence different physiological functions, including pain relief, circulation improvement, and immune system enhancement. Many pet owners are turning to this therapy as an alternative or complementary treatment for a variety of conditions, particularly in dogs.

How Dog Acupuncture Works

Just like in humans, dog acupuncture works by stimulating nerve endings, muscles, and connective tissues. This stimulation triggers the release of natural pain-relieving chemicals like endorphins and serotonin, helping to reduce pain and inflammation. The increased blood circulation promotes faster healing and enhances the overall well-being of your furry friend.

Conditions Treated by Animal Acupuncture

Veterinarians recommend animal acupuncture for a wide range of conditions, including:

  • Arthritis and Joint Pain: Many older dogs suffer from arthritis, which can significantly affect their mobility. Dog acupuncture helps alleviate discomfort and improve movement.
  • Neurological Disorders: Pets with nerve-related issues, such as intervertebral disc disease (IVDD), can benefit from acupuncture as it helps restore nerve function.
  • Gastrointestinal Problems: Digestive disorders like diarrhea, vomiting, and bloating can be managed through acupuncture by promoting better gut function.
  • Post-Surgical Recovery: Acupuncture is an excellent option for speeding up the healing process after surgery by reducing pain and inflammation.
  • Allergies and Skin Conditions: Many pets suffer from chronic allergies and dermatological issues, which acupuncture can help manage by strengthening their immune response.

What to Expect During an Acupuncture Session

A typical animal acupuncture session lasts between 20 to 40 minutes. During the treatment, your pet may feel minimal discomfort as the needles are inserted. Most animals become relaxed, and some even fall asleep during the session! The number of sessions required depends on the condition being treated, with some pets showing improvement after just one session, while others may need multiple treatments for long-term benefits.
